ip命令式用来配置网卡ip信息的命令,且是未来的趋势,重启网卡后IP失效

ip常见命令参数

  1. Usage: ip [ OPTIONS ] OBJECT { COMMAND | help }
  2. ip [ -force ] -batch filename
  3. where OBJECT := { link | addr | addrlabel | route | rule | neigh | ntable |
  4. tunnel | maddr | mroute | mrule | monitor | xfrm }
  5. OPTIONS := { -V[ersion] | -s[tatistics] | -d[etails] | -r[esolve] |
  6. -f[amily] { inet | inet6 | ipx | dnet | link } |
  7. -o[neline] | -t[imestamp] | -b[atch] [filename] |
  8. -rc[vbuf] [size]}

ip addr 常见命令参数

  1. Usage: ip addr {add|change|replace} IFADDR dev STRING [ LIFETIME ]
  2. [ CONFFLAG-LIST]
  3. ip addr del IFADDR dev STRING
  4. ip addr {show|flush} [ dev STRING ] [ scope SCOPE-ID ]
  5. [ to PREFIX ] [ FLAG-LIST ] [ label PATTERN ]
  6. IFADDR := PREFIX | ADDR peer PREFIX
  7. [ broadcast ADDR ] [ anycast ADDR ]
  8. [ label STRING ] [ scope SCOPE-ID ]
  9. SCOPE-ID := [ host | link | global | NUMBER ]
  10. FLAG-LIST := [ FLAG-LIST ] FLAG
  11. FLAG := [ permanent | dynamic | secondary | primary |
  12. tentative | deprecated | CONFFLAG-LIST ]
  13. CONFFLAG-LIST := [ CONFFLAG-LIST ] CONFFLAG
  14. CONFFLAG := [ home | nodad ]
  15. LIFETIME := [ valid_lft LFT ] [ preferred_lft LFT ]
  16. LFT := forever | SECONDS

常用的命令展示

为网卡配置和删除IPv4地址  【临时生效,永久生效需要更改配置文件】

eth2网卡配置文件: /etc/sysconfig/network-scripts/ifcfg-eth2

  1. [root@localhost ~]# ip addr add 192.168.25.166/24  dev eth0 
  1. [root@localhost ~]# ifconfig eth0 192.168.25.166 netmask 255.255.255.0 up 【效果同上】
  1. [root@localhost ~]# ifconfig eth0 192.168.25.166/24 up 【效果同上】

  1. [root@localhost ~]# ip addr add 192.168.25.166/24  dev eth0:ws 
  1. [root@localhost ~]# ifconfig eth0:ws 192.168.25.166/24 up 【效果同上】
  1. [root@localhost ~]# ifconfig eth0:ws 192.168.25.166 netmask 255.255.255.0 up 【效果同上】

  1. [root@localhost ~]# ip addr del 192.168.25.166/24  dev eth0:ws 
  1. [root@localhost ~]# ifconfig eth0:ws 192.168.25.166 netmask 255.255.255.0 down 【效果同上】
  1. [root@localhost ~]# ifconfig eth0:ws 192.168.25.166/24 dwon 【效果同上】

Linux ip命令详解的更多相关文章

  1. linux awk命令详解

    linux awk命令详解 简介 awk是一个强大的文本分析工具,相对于grep的查找,sed的编辑,awk在其对数据分析并生成报告时,显得尤为强大.简单来说awk就是把文件逐行的读入,以空格为默认分 ...

  2. Linux netstat命令详解

    Linux netstat命令详解 一  简介 Netstat 命令用于显示各种网络相关信息,如网络连接,路由表,接口状态 (Interface Statistics),masquerade 连接,多 ...

  3. linux lsof命令详解

    linux lsof命令详解 简介 lsof(list open files)是一个列出当前系统打开文件的工具.在linux环境下,任何事物都以文件的形式存在,通过文件不仅仅可以访问常规数据,还可以访 ...

  4. linux netstat 命令详解

    linux netstat 命令详解 1.功能与说明 netstat 用于显示linux中各种网络相关信息.如网络链接 路由表  接口状态链接 多播成员等等. 2.参数含义介绍 -a (all)显示所 ...

  5. Linux lsof命令详解和使用示例【转】

    所以如传输控制协议 (TCP) 和用户数据报协议 (UDP) 套接字等,系统在后台都为该应用程序分配了一个文件描述符,无论这个文件的本质如何,该文件描述符为应用程序与基础操作系统之间的交互提供了通用接 ...

  6. (转)linux route命令详解

    linux route命令详解 原文:https://www.cnblogs.com/lpfuture/p/5857738.html   &&   http://blog.csdn.n ...

  7. Linux curl 命令详解

    命令概要 该命令设计用于在没有用户交互的情况下工作. curl 是一个工具,用于传输来自服务器或者到服务器的数据.「向服务器传输数据或者获取来自服务器的数据」 可支持的协议有(DICT.FILE.FT ...

  8. [转贴]linux lsof命令详解

    linux lsof命令详解 https://www.cnblogs.com/sparkbj/p/7161669.html 简介 lsof(list open files)是一个列出当前系统打开文件的 ...

  9. linux awk命令详解,使用system来内嵌系统命令, awk合并两列

    linux awk命令详解 简介 awk是一个强大的文本分析工具,相对于grep的查找,sed的编辑,awk在其对数据分析并生成报告时,显得尤为强大.简单来说awk就是把文件逐行的读入,以空格为默认分 ...

随机推荐

  1. Linux时间命令

    Linux一般有系统时间和硬件时间之分,date命令是显示和操作系统时间:hwclock用来操作硬件时间(日期).日期和时间很重要,比如错误的日期和时间会导致你不能编译程序. 1 date 用法:   ...

  2. 3YAdmin-专注通用权限控制与表单的后台管理系统模板

    3YAdmin基于React+Antd构建.GitHub搜索React+Antd+Admin出来的结果没有上百也有几十个,为什么还要写这个东西呢? 一个后台管理系统的核心我认为应该是权限控制,表单以及 ...

  3. 利用扩展方法重写JSON序列化和反序列化

    利用.NET 3.5以后的扩展方法重写JSON序列化和反序列化,在代码可读性和可维护性上更加加强了. 首先是不使用扩展方法的写法 定义部分: /// <summary>  /// JSON ...

  4. [C语言] 数据结构-预备知识动态内存分配

    动态内存分配 静态内存分配数组 int a[5]={1,2,3,4,5}  动态内存分配数组 int len=5; int *parr=(int *)malloc(sizeof(int) * len) ...

  5. Ubuntu16.04 LTS上安装Go1.10

    原因 Ubuntu资源库上默认使用的是Go1.6.2版本,给最新版本代码编译带来了不少问题.本文就记录下在Ubuntu下直接安装Go最新版1.10的步骤. 准备工作 1.卸载已有版本 # 卸载已经安装 ...

  6. winform:简单文件资源管理器

    今天全部学习内容的体现就是winform的资源管理器.这个资源管理器主要由一个textbox获取路径,然后在treeview那里通过递归的方式呈现目录树,当用户点击treeview的节点是,会触发Af ...

  7. Java Web中涉及的编解码

    用户从浏览器发起一个HTTP请求,存在编码的地方是URL.Cookie.Paramiter.服务器端接收到HTTP请求后要解析HTTP协议,其中URL.Cookie和POST表单参数要解码,服务器端可 ...

  8. 记录:springmvc + mybatis + maven 搭建配置流程

    前言:不会配置 spring mvc,不知道为什么那样配置,也不知道从何下手,那么看这里就对了. 在 IDEA 中搭建 maven + springmvc + mybatis: 一.在 IDEA 中首 ...

  9. 各种IDE的使用

    sharpdevelop http://blog.sina.com.cn/s/blog_d1001bff0101di7p.html

  10. 小程序视图层(xx.xml)和逻辑层(xx.js)

    整个系统分为两块视图层(View)和逻辑层(App Service) 框架可以让数据与视图非常简单地保持同步.当做数据修改的时候,只需要在逻辑层修改数据,视图层就会做相应的更新. 通过这个简单的例子来 ...